Package google.apps.script.type.calendar

אינדקס

CalendarAddOnManifest

מאפיינים שמשנים את המראה וההפעלה של תוסף ליומן.

שדות
homepageTrigger

HomepageExtensionPoint

אופציונלי. הגדרה של נקודת קצה שמופעלת בהקשרים שלא תואמים לטריגר הקשרי מוצהר. כל הכרטיסים שנוצרים על ידי הפונקציה הזו תמיד יהיו זמינים למשתמש, אבל יכול להיות שהם יוסתרו על ידי תוכן הקשרי כשהתוסף הזה יצהיר על טריגרים ממוקדים יותר.

אם הפרמטר הזה קיים, הוא מבטל את ההגדרה מ-addOns.common.homepageTrigger.

conferenceSolution[]

ConferenceSolution

אופציונלי. הגדרה של פתרונות לשיחות ועידה שהתוסף הזה מספק.

createSettingsUrlFunction

string

נקודת קצה להרצה שיוצרת כתובת URL לדף ההגדרות של התוסף.

eventOpenTrigger

CalendarExtensionPoint

נקודת קצה שמופעלת כשפותחים אירוע כדי לצפות בו או לערוך אותו.

eventUpdateTrigger

CalendarExtensionPoint

נקודת קצה שמופעלת כשאירוע הפתיחה מתעדכן.

calendarNotificationTrigger

CalendarExtensionPoint

אופציונלי. הטריגר מופעל כשאירוע נוצר או מתעדכן ביומן שהמשתמש רשום אליו. ההגדרה הזו חלה רק על טריגרים שנוצרו על ידי HTTP endpoints באמצעות CalendarSubscriptionActionMarkup. לא רלוונטי ל-Apps Script add-ons ול-Apps Script installable triggers.

eventAttachmentTrigger

MenuItemExtensionPoint

הגדרה של טריגר הקשרי שמופעל כשהמשתמש לוחץ על ספק הקבצים המצורפים לתוסף בתפריט הנפתח של היומן.

currentEventAccess

EventAccess

הגדרה של רמת הגישה לנתונים כשמופעל תוסף לאירועים.

EventAccess

סוג enum שמגדיר את רמת הגישה לנתונים שנדרשת להפעלת אירועים.

טיפוסים בני מנייה (enum)
UNSPECIFIED ערך ברירת המחדל אם לא מוגדר כלום ל-eventAccess.
METADATA נותן לטריגרים של אירועים את ההרשאה לגשת למטא נתונים של אירועים, כמו מזהה האירוע ומזהה היומן.
READ נותן לטריגרים של אירועים גישה לכל שדות האירועים שסופקו, כולל המטא-נתונים, המשתתפים והפרטים של שיחת הוועידה.
WRITE נותן לטריגרים של אירועים גישה למטא-נתונים של אירועים ואפשרות לבצע את כל הפעולות, כולל הוספת משתתפים והגדרת נתוני שיחות ועידה.
READ_WRITE נותן לטריגרים של אירועים גישה לכל שדות האירועים שסופקו, כולל המטא-נתונים, המשתתפים ונתוני הוועידה, וגם את היכולת לבצע את כל הפעולות.

CalendarExtensionPoint

פורמט נפוץ להצהרה על טריגרים של תוסף ליומן.

שדות
runFunction

string

חובה. נקודת הקצה להפעלה כשנקודת ההרחבה הזו מופעלת.

ConferenceSolution

הגדרת ערכים שקשורים לוועידה.

שדות
onCreateFunction

string

חובה. נקודת הקצה שאליה מתקשרים כשצריך ליצור נתונים של שיחות ועידה.

id

string

חובה. צריך להקצות מזהים באופן ייחודי לכל פתרונות הוועידה בתוסף אחד, אחרת יכול להיות שהפתרון הלא נכון לשיחות ועידה ישמש כשהתוסף יופעל. אפשר לשנות את השם המוצג של תוסף, אבל לא מומלץ לשנות את המזהה.

name

string

חובה. השם המוצג של פתרון הוועידה.

logoUrl

string

חובה. כתובת ה-URL של תמונת הלוגו של פתרון הוועידה.